  • Patent number: 7714087
    Abstract: A polar group-containing olefin copolymer having excellent adhesion properties to metals or polar resins and excellent compatibility therewith, a process for preparing the copolymer, a thermoplastic resin composition containing the copolymer, and uses thereof. The polar group-containing olefin copolymer comprises a constituent unit derived from an ?-olefin of 2 to 20 carbon atoms, and a constituent unit derived from a straight-chain, branched or cyclic polar group-containing monomer having at the end a polar group such as a hydroxyl group or an epoxy group and/or a constituent unit derived from a macromonomer having at the end a polymer segment obtained by anionic polymerization, ring-opening polymerization or polycondensation. The polar group-containing olefin copolymer can be prepared by polymerizing the ?-olefin with the polar group-containing monomer and/or the macromonomer in the presence of a metallocene catalyst.

  • Patent number: 6528599
    Abstract: The present invention provides a method of preparing a polymer, which comprises subjecting a monomer containing at least a polar unsaturated compound to anionic polymerization in the presence of a phosphazenium compound represented by the formula (1): (wherein Z− is an anion of an active hydrogen compound in the form where a proton is eliminated from the active hydrogen compound and transferred to the anion; a, b, c and d each represents 1 or 0, but all of them are not simultaneously 0; and R may the same or different and each represents a hydrocarbon group having 1 to 10 carbon atoms, and two R(s) on the same nitrogen atom are optionally combined each other to form a cyclic structure), or in the presence of the phosphazenium compound and the active hydrogen compound. The resulting polymer is characterized by narrow molecular weight distribution.

  • Patent number: 6469224
    Abstract: A substituted aromatic compound substituted with Q is obtained by reacting a phosphazenium compound represented by formula (1) (in the formula, Q− represents an anion in a form derived by elimination of a proton from an inorganic acid, or an active hydrogen compound having an active hydrogen on an oxygen atom, a nitrogen atom or a sulfur atom; a, b, c and d, each independently, is 0 or 1, but all of them are not 0 simultaneously; and R groups represent the same or different hydrocarbon groups having 1 to 10 carbon atoms, or two Rs on each common nitrogen atom may be bonded together to form a ring structure) with a halogenated aromatic compound having halogen atoms; whereby, at least one halogen atom in the halogenated aromatic compound is substituted with Q (where, Q represents an inorganic group or an organic group in a form derived by elimination of one electron from Q− in formula (1)).

  • Patent number: 6444847
    Abstract: A process for preparing phosphine oxides by reacting iminophosphoranes with phosphorus oxytrichloride by which highly purified phosphine oxides can be obtained industrially in a higher yield. Specifically, phosphine oxides are prepared in such a manner that iminophosphoranes are reacted with phosphorus oxytrichloride using an aprotic organic solvent with permittivity 2.2 or more at 20° C. as a solvent under special reaction conditions to give a liquid reaction product containing phosphine oxides and aminophosphonium chlorides which are yielded as a by-product at the same time as the phosphine oxides, and the above described chlorides are removed from the above described liquid reaction product by a solid-liquid separation process, and the solution having been subjected to the solid-liquid separation process is washed with water.
